This beautifully presented, Grade II listed timber framed cottage has been sympathetically maintained and refurbished over the years by the current owners to now provide light, spacious and flexible living accommodation blending character features and modern convenience effortlessly. Particular mention must be made of the breakfast kitchen with island unit, stone worktops and bi fold doors to the patio, the principal bedroom suite with fitted wardrobes, dressing area and en-suite bathroom as well as the fantastic character features found throughout including thatched roof, exposed timber frame and stone fireplace. There has also recently been the addition of the timber lodge to the front of the property offering a multitude of opportunities with fantastic open plan living for dependent relatives, older children or as a home office.
Located in a charming position in a very secluded spot on one of the areas most sought after roads with stunning views to the rear over adjoining countryside, close to The Bells of Peover Public House and Lower Peover Primary School whilst being ideally positioned for all major network links to the Northwest and beyond.
The property is approached over a sweeping gravel driveway, providing ample off-road parking, leading to the detached timber lodge and along a stone and cobbled pathway to the property. The front gardens are lawned in the main with mature trees and hedging giving a high degree of privacy, retained by post and rail fencing. The rear gardens are a lovely feature of the property, being of generous proportions with a private, open aspect enjoying stunning views over adjoining countryside. Laid to lawn with borders surrounding and features trees, fully enclosed by mature hedging and fencing. Stone flagged patio area, accessed off the main reception rooms and breakfast kitchen provides ideal opportunity for alfresco dining and enjoying the lovely outlook.
